PRINTMAKING COURSE ON A SATELLITE

by Kirsten Muchitsch Hesselager

Mondays

Printmaking is a big and wonderful world. Each technique has its own form of expression, which gives very different images. In the printing process, something surprising and often magical always emerges.

We will work with various graphic techniques such as cardboard printing (collography), cold needle etching (plexiglass or copper), lino printing, electric etching and monotype. Please bring sketches or photo ideas for motifs. Also bring pencil, sketch paper, practical clothes, coffee/tea. There will be costs for materials (plates, paper and printing ink), which will be purchased at the course. The course is aimed at all beginners and experienced.

ETCHING IN COPPER

with Trine Anderschou

 

25.- 27. april

 

The course is primarily aimed at intermediate learners, but you will be met at your individual level.

You will work in copper plates, primarily with line etching and the shades of gray in plain aquatint. Basic etching techniques and printing will be demonstrated and tested.

To make the most of the time, it is a good idea to bring a small sketch (approx. 10×10 cm) for an etching, the motif of which is simple and contains parts with the colors white, black and 2 shades of grey.

Prepared copper plates, tarlatan and paper can be purchased at the course. Cold needles and brushes can be borrowed from Trine.

CYANOTYPI

by Lone V. Petersen 

 

28.- 29. juni   

 

Cyanotype is magic and chemistry. It is a printing technique where the sun is used as an exposure source. It is a playful and experimental technique where you cannot always completely control the result. It is also one of the world's oldest photographic printing techniques invented in 1842 by John Herschel. The technique was used in 1843 by the British botanist Anna Atkins for her beautiful and sensuous cyanotypes of seaweed and algae. By mixing two different chemicals and water, a light-sensitive emulsion is obtained, which is applied to paper (or other materials that can withstand being placed in water). We will experiment with lighting times, "wet cyanotype", adding salt, spices, soap suds, etc., and we will try bleaching and toning the cyanotypes. Feel free to bring flowers and plants (possibly pressed) and digital photos that can be used to make transparencies, flat objects, templates... and sunshine!

COLLOGRAFI

with Line Eskestad

SEPTEMBER 12.-14

The metal plate has been replaced with cardboard: We engrave, cut, emboss and apply layers upon layers with glue. It is both letterpress and intaglio and both black and white and color. Come and play and experiment!

GELLI-PRINT

By Linea Hansen

AUGUST 22.- 23.

Many artists use the gelli printing technique in combination with their own methods: for example, collography or linoleum; I use it in connection with my fish prints. With these soft plates, you can use acrylic paints, posca markers, etc. and a number of objects to create patterns in the color to get motifs/backgrounds in countless variations. In addition to making color prints, you will also make transfers of photos and a mixture of the two.

It will be possible to purchase a number of plates at Fyns Grafiske Værksted. Bring: All sorts of objects that can create structure in the paint. Cardboard, plastic, textiles e.g. old lace, feathers, metal objects e.g. capsules and keys, seed pods and plant parts.
